Factors to Consider When Choosing Fly Boxes for Fly Fishing
When you're picking a fly box for your fishing adventures, think about what it's made of and how durable it is. You'll also want to contemplate how much it can hold, how well it organizes your flies, and whether it's waterproof. Don't forget to check the closure for security and how easy it is to carry around.
Material and Durability
While selecting the ideal fly box, focus on the material and durability to guarantee it meets your fishing needs. Opt for high-density ABS plastic or medical-grade silicone, as they offer excellent resistance to impacts and harsh environmental conditions. Waterproof features are vital, so look for boxes with silicone gaskets or rubber seals to keep your flies dry and safe. Consider fly boxes made from recycled materials; they're not only eco-friendly but also durable against extreme temperatures. The design is equally important—choose boxes with clear lids and strong closures for easy access and longevity. Don't overlook the foam inserts; verify they're high-quality and tear-resistant to withstand various fishing conditions without compromising on fly security.
Capacity and Organization
The right fly box can make all the difference in how effectively you organize and store your flies. When selecting a fly box, consider its capacity; options range from holding 96 to 336 flies. This variety lets you tailor your organization to fit your fishing needs. Look for features like compartments or silicone anchoring technology, which securely hold flies and prevent tangling or damage. Make sure the box's dimensions match your storage preferences. Compact boxes slip easily into pockets or vests, while larger ones offer more organization but require more space. Evaluate how easy it is to access your flies. Clear lids or see-through designs enhance quick selection, making it easier to stay organized while you're out on the water.
Waterproof Features
Although you might be tempted to overlook waterproof features when choosing a fly box, they're essential for keeping your flies dry and ready for action. Waterproof fly boxes use silicone seals or gaskets to block water intrusion, guaranteeing your gear stays dry and functional. Opt for designs like double-sided boxes, which enhance waterproofing and maximize storage for various fly patterns. High-quality materials, such as ABS plastic, provide durability in extreme conditions and maintain the box's structural integrity over time. Additionally, a floating fly box can be a lifesaver, making retrieval easy if dropped in water and preventing gear loss. Prioritizing these features guarantees you're prepared for any fishing adventure, regardless of weather or water conditions.
Closure and Security
When choosing a fly box, you can't overlook closure and security features, as they play an important role in protecting your flies. Opt for a closure mechanism that suits your fishing style. Magnetic closures offer quick access, but latch systems provide a more secure seal against water. Some models boast strong latchless designs to prevent accidental openings. Waterproof seals, like silicone gaskets, are vital for keeping flies dry in various conditions. The materials used in a fly box, such as high-quality plastics and reinforced components, influence closure effectiveness. Pay attention to user feedback, which can reveal potential weaknesses in locking mechanisms, like concerns about plastic latches or magnet strength. Choose wisely to guarantee your flies stay safe and dry.
